Handover note — Crumbwheel order cutoffs.

Welcome aboard. The bakery cutoff rule in Crumbwheel closes same-day orders at 14:00 local to each storefront, not UTC — this has bitten us twice. Holiday overrides live in the calendar service and take precedence silently, so always check there first when a cutoff looks wrong. To unlock the calendar service's admin console after a restart, enter the recovery passphrase below.

vault phrase of bagap-bahaf = silion-pelox-sorox-casdor-quenwyn-fraax-eliox-praael-kelion-quenvan-kasox-rusael-norius-belvan

Handover note, Director Mabbs to Director Corven, copied to the board. Logistics provider switched from Graywharf Freight to Tannet Line effective next month. Contract signed; termination fees with Graywharf settled. Transition plan: two-week parallel running, then full cutover. Key risks: cold-chain capacity in the Eastmoor depot and untested peak-season volumes. Service credits negotiated for missed delivery windows. Cost saving projected at 9% annually. Outstanding items tracked by operations. Confidential business context is appended below.

board note of yajeg-yaweg: The pricing group signed off on a budget of $4.9 million for Project Quenix. The renewal with Sormirek Freight closes at $6.1 million a year, 37 percent below the last contract.

- [ ] **Step 7: Breaker override escrow.** After sealing the signing keys for the Tallgrove upstream API circuit breaker, confirm the support team can force the breaker open during a full outage. The override bundle lives in the sealed escrow drawer and is useless without its unlock phrase. Two ceremony witnesses must initial this step before proceeding. The escrow bundle is decrypted with the recovery passphrase that follows.

vault phrase of kahip-kahop = holath-quenmir